Shorewall Geek wrote: > Hard to say. Multi-ISP works differently for connections originating on > the firewall itself which is what occurs when you run a Proxy on the > firewall. See http://www.shorewall.net/MultiISP.html#Local. >
One thing you might try is to set the 'loose' option on both providers.
